What Is Off Leash Dog Training? A Quick Answer
Off leash training teaches your dog to listen and respond to commands even without a leash, physical correction, or close supervision. It goes far beyond basic obedience. Your dog learns to come when called, stay in place, heel beside you, and disengage from distractions on command. Therefore, off-leash training is one of the highest levels of communication you can build with your dog.
This skill set is especially valuable in Carefree, where desert trails, open parks, and outdoor patios create constant real-world distractions. A dog with solid off-leash training is safer, calmer, and simply more enjoyable to spend time with.

What Real-World Proofing Looks Like in Arizona
Training inside a quiet facility is only the beginning. Real-world proofing means exposing your dog to the kinds of distractions they encounter every day. Rob’s Dogs takes dogs to parks, shopping centers, and busy outdoor areas across the Valley. For example, a Carefree dog might be proofed around hiking trail foot traffic, cyclists, other dogs, and desert wildlife smells.
This step is critical for off-leash reliability. A dog that only performs in calm settings will fail at the trailhead. However, a dog that has been proofed in real Arizona environments holds their training when it counts most. Rob’s Dogs builds this into every program systematically rather than leaving it to chance.

Can older dogs learn off leash skills?
Yes, older dogs can absolutely learn off-leash commands. The process may take more repetition compared to puppies. However, adult dogs are often more focused and less impulsive, which can be an advantage. Rob’s Dogs has worked successfully with dogs of all ages across the Valley.
